Cambrai, France – Charles Segard, a resident of Cambrai, passed away on Friday, March 6, 2026, at his home at the age of 91. The news of his death has prompted an outpouring of grief from family and friends, marking the conclude of a life lived fully through nine decades. His passing was announced by his wife, Thérèse Segard-Ruffin, and his daughter, Sophie Guidez-Segard, along with her husband, Claude Guidez-Segard.

Funeral Arrangements and Memorial Services

A religious ceremony to celebrate Charles Segard’s life will be held on Friday, March 13, 2026, at 10:00 AM in the Saint-Géry church in Ramillies. Following the ceremony, a cremation will capture place at the Caudry crematorium. Family members have requested that attendees gather at the church beginning at 9:45 AM. Prior to the funeral, Mr. Segard will be resting at the Proville funeral home, located at 142 rue Charles de Montesquieu, 59267 Proville. The family invites those wishing to pay their respects to visit the funeral home during this time.
